St Kilda considering approaching AFL for priority pick

2019-07-18T11:50+10:00

St Kilda head of football Simon Lethlean says the club will consider approaching the AFL for a priority pick in this year’s draft.

The Saints have been without a host of players due to unforeseen circumstances this season, including Dylan Roberton (heart), Jack Steven (mental health) and Paddy McCartin (concussion).

"It's an interesting scenario, we've also got Billy Longer and Lewis Pierce (out through concussion)," Lethlean told SEN Breakfast.

"We've certainly got some unusual circumstances that don't relate to soft tissue and other injuries that could have a significant effect on our TPP (Total Player Payments) and our ability to manage our list as well as you could for reasons that are a bit out of our control.

"We'll certainly have conversations internally with the AFL about how that looks for us going forward. I think that's a fair question to raise."

St Kilda parted ways with coach Alan Richardson earlier in the week with assistant Brett Ratten taking over as caretaker.

Ratten will be aiming to get a win in his first game as Saints coach when they take on the Western Bulldogs at Marvel Stadium on Sunday.
